About

E. Neil Lewis is a scholar working on Biophysics, Analytical Chemistry and Molecular Biology. According to data from OpenAlex, E. Neil Lewis has authored 70 papers receiving a total of 2.6k indexed citations (citations by other indexed papers that have themselves been cited), including 43 papers in Biophysics, 31 papers in Analytical Chemistry and 16 papers in Molecular Biology. Recurrent topics in E. Neil Lewis's work include Spectroscopy Techniques in Biomedical and Chemical Research (43 papers), Spectroscopy and Chemometric Analyses (31 papers) and Optical Imaging and Spectroscopy Techniques (10 papers). E. Neil Lewis is often cited by papers focused on Spectroscopy Techniques in Biomedical and Chemical Research (43 papers), Spectroscopy and Chemometric Analyses (31 papers) and Optical Imaging and Spectroscopy Techniques (10 papers). E. Neil Lewis collaborates with scholars based in United States, Germany and United Kingdom. E. Neil Lewis's co-authors include Ira W. Levin, Patrick J. Treado, Linda H. Kidder, V. F. Kalasinsky, Curtis Marcott, Michael D. Schaeberle, Qi Wei, Anthony E. Dowrey, Gloria M. Story and Robert C. Reeder and has published in prestigious journals such as Nature Medicine, The Journal of Chemical Physics and Analytical Chemistry.
